Türkçe

Vergi yazılımı hesaplama algoritmalarının karmaşıklıklarını, doğruluğunu ve küresel uygulamalarını keşfedin.

Vergi Yazılımını Çözümlemek: Hesaplama Algoritmalarına Derinlemesine Bakış

Vergi yazılımı, dünya çapında bireyler ve işletmeler için vazgeçilmez bir araç haline gelerek, vergi hazırlığını kolaylaştırmakta ve sürekli değişen vergi yasalarına uyumu sağlamaktadır. Bu teknolojinin kalbinde, karmaşık hesaplamaları otomatikleştirerek hataları en aza indiren ve değerli zaman kazandıran gelişmiş hesaplama algoritmaları bulunmaktadır. Bu makale, bu algoritmaların temel ilkelerini, işlevselliklerini ve küresel vergi manzarasındaki önemini inceleyerek, bu algoritmaların karmaşık dünyasına dalmaktadır.

Vergi Hesaplama Algoritmaları Nelerdir?

Vergi hesaplama algoritmaları, kullanıcı tarafından sağlanan verilere göre vergi yükümlülüklerini belirlemek için vergi yazılımına programlanmış bir dizi kural ve formüldür. Bu algoritmalar, aşağıdakileri içeren geniş bir hesaplama yelpazesini kapsar:

Bu algoritmalar, yazılımın doğru ve uyumlu kalmasını sağlayarak, vergi yasalarındaki ve düzenlemelerdeki değişiklikleri yansıtmak için sürekli olarak güncellenir.

Vergi Algoritmalarının Yapı Taşları

Vergi hesaplama algoritmaları, çeşitli temel bileşenler üzerine kurulmuştur:

Veri Girişi ve Doğrulama

Vergi hesaplamalarının doğruluğu, veri girişinin kalitesine bağlıdır. Vergi yazılımı, gelir, giderler ve indirimler gibi finansal bilgileri girmek için genellikle kullanıcı dostu arayüzler sağlar. Yazılım ayrıca, giriş verilerinin eksiksiz, tutarlı ve doğru olmasını sağlayarak hataları belirlemek ve önlemek için veri doğrulama mekanizmaları içerir.

Örnek: E-ticaret için bir satış vergisi hesaplama algoritması, doğru yargı yetkisini ve vergi oranını belirlemek için doğru gönderim adreslerine ihtiyaç duyacaktır. Veri doğrulaması, posta kodu formatını kontrol etmeyi ve geçerli bir konumla eşleştirmeyi içerir.

Vergi Kuralları ve Düzenlemeleri

Vergi yasaları karmaşıktır ve yargı yetkisi alanlarında önemli ölçüde farklılık gösterir. Vergi yazılımı, vergi oranları, indirimler, krediler ve muafiyetler dahil olmak üzere kapsamlı vergi kuralları ve düzenlemeleri veritabanlarını içerir. Bu veritabanları, yazılımın uyumlu kalmasını sağlayarak, vergi yasalarındaki değişiklikleri yansıtmak için düzenli olarak güncellenir.

Örnek: AB'de, KDV oranları ülkeye ve bazen ürün türüne göre değişir. Algoritma, doğru KDV oranını uygulamak için satış ülkesini ve ürün kategorisini doğru bir şekilde belirlemelidir.

Hesaplama Mantığı

Hesaplama mantığı, algoritmanın kalbidir ve giriş verilerine ve vergi kurallarına dayalı olarak vergi yükümlülüklerini hesaplamak için gereken adımları tanımlar. Bu mantık genellikle çeşitli senaryoları ve istisnaları hesaba katan karmaşık formülleri ve karar ağaçlarını içerir.

Örnek: Gelir vergisini hesaplamak, ayarlanmış brüt gelir (AGI) belirlemek, indirimleri maddeleştirmek ve dosyalama durumuna göre uygun vergi dilimlerini uygulamak gibi birden fazla adım içerebilir.

Raporlama ve Uygunluk

Vergi yazılımı sadece vergi yükümlülüklerini hesaplamakla kalmaz, aynı zamanda vergi beyanı için gerekli raporları ve formları da oluşturur. Bu raporlar, hesaplamaların ayrıntılı bir dökümünü sağlayarak şeffaflık sağlar ve uyumu kolaylaştırır. Yazılım ayrıca, kullanıcıların vergi beyannamelerini doğrudan vergi dairelerine göndermelerini sağlayan elektronik dosyalama özelliğini de destekler.

Örnek: Yazılım, işletmelere önemli ölçüde zaman ve çaba tasarrufu sağlayarak, farklı AB üye devletleri için gerekli formatta otomatik olarak KDV beyannameleri oluşturabilir.

Vergi Algoritması Tasarımında Temel Hususlar

Etkili vergi hesaplama algoritmaları tasarlamak, çeşitli faktörlerin dikkatlice değerlendirilmesini gerektirir:

Doğruluk

Doğruluk her şeyden önemlidir. Vergi algoritmaları, tutarlı bir şekilde doğru sonuçlar ürettiklerinden emin olmak için titizlikle tasarlanmalı ve test edilmelidir. Hesaplamalardaki herhangi bir hatayı veya tutarsızlığı belirlemek ve düzeltmek için titiz testler esastır.

Uyum

Vergi algoritmaları, geçerli tüm vergi yasalarına ve düzenlemelerine uymalıdır. Bu, vergi yasası değişikliklerinin sürekli izlenmesini ve yazılımın zamanında güncellenmesini gerektirir.

Performans

Vergi algoritmaları, hesaplamaların hızlı ve verimli bir şekilde tamamlanmasını sağlayarak, optimum performans için tasarlanmalıdır. Bu, özellikle karmaşık vergi yükümlülükleri olan büyük kuruluşlar için önemlidir.

Ölçeklenebilirlik

Vergi algoritmaları, büyüyen veri hacimlerini ve artan karmaşıklığı karşılayacak şekilde ölçeklenebilir olmalıdır. Bu, yazılımın işletmelerin geliştikçe kullanıcıların ihtiyaçlarını karşılamaya devam etmesini sağlar.

Kullanılabilirlik

Vergi yazılımı, sınırlı vergi bilgisine sahip kullanıcılar için bile kullanıcı dostu ve gezinmesi kolay olmalıdır. Açık talimatlar, yardımcı ipuçları ve sezgisel arayüzler, kullanıcı deneyimini iyileştirebilir ve hataları en aza indirebilir.

Vergi Algoritması Uygulamalarına Örnekler

Vergi hesaplama algoritmaları, aşağıdakiler dahil olmak üzere çeşitli vergi yazılımı türlerinde uygulanmaktadır:

Vergi Hazırlama Yazılımı

Vergi hazırlama yazılımı, bireylerin ve küçük işletmelerin vergi beyannamelerini hazırlamaları ve dosyalamaları için tasarlanmıştır. Bu programlar genellikle kullanıcı dostu arayüzler, adım adım rehberlik ve vergi yükümlülüklerinin otomatik hesaplanmasını sunar.

Örnek: TurboTax (Intuit) ve H&R Block gibi popüler vergi hazırlama yazılım paketleri, kullanıcıların vergi beyannamelerini doğru bir şekilde tamamlamalarına yardımcı olmak için yönlendirilmiş görüşmeler ve otomatik hesaplamalar sağlar.

Vergi Uyumluluk Yazılımı

Vergi uyumluluk yazılımı, işletmelerin gelir vergisi, satış vergisi ve KDV dahil olmak üzere vergi yükümlülüklerini yönetmek için kullanılır. Bu programlar, vergi planlaması, vergi tahmini ve otomatik vergi raporlaması gibi gelişmiş özellikler sunar.

Örnek: Şirketler, birden fazla ABD eyaletinde satış vergisi otomasyonu için Avalara gibi yazılımlar kullanır ve Avrupa ve diğer bölgelerde KDV uyumu için benzer çözümler mevcuttur.

Vergi Motoru Yazılımı

Vergi motoru yazılımı, diğer uygulamalara vergi hesaplama hizmetleri sağlayan özel bir yazılım türüdür. Bu motorlar genellikle e-ticaret platformlarına, muhasebe sistemlerine ve kurumsal kaynak planlama (ERP) sistemlerine entegre edilerek, vergi hesaplamalarını gerçek zamanlı olarak otomatikleştirir.

Örnek: E-ticaret platformları genellikle, müşterinin gönderim adresine göre her işlem için otomatik olarak satış vergisini hesaplamak için vergi motorlarıyla entegre olur.

Vergi Algoritmaları Geliştirirken Karşılaşılan Zorluklar

Vergi hesaplama algoritmaları geliştirmek çeşitli zorluklar sunar:

Vergi Yasalarının Karmaşıklığı

Vergi yasaları karmaşıktır ve sürekli değişmektedir, bu da geliştiricilerin en son düzenlemeleri takip etmesini ve yazılımı buna göre güncellemesini gerektirir.

Veri Entegrasyonu

Vergi yazılımını muhasebe yazılımı ve ERP sistemleri gibi diğer sistemlerle entegre etmek, veri formatlarındaki ve protokollerdeki farklılıklar nedeniyle zorlayıcı olabilir.

Uluslararası Vergi

Birden fazla yargı yetkisinde vergi hesaplamak, farklı vergi yasaları, vergi oranları ve raporlama gereklilikleri hakkında bilgi gerektiren özellikle karmaşık olabilir.

Yerelleştirme

Vergi yazılımını farklı dillere, para birimlerine ve kültürel normlara uyarlamak zorlayıcı olabilir.

Vergi Algoritmalarının Geleceği

Vergi hesaplama algoritmalarının geleceği, çeşitli eğilimler tarafından şekillendirilme olasılığı yüksektir:

Yapay Zeka (YZ) ve Makine Öğrenimi (MÖ)

YZ ve MÖ teknolojileri, vergi uyumluluğunu otomatikleştirmek, vergi sahtekarlığını tespit etmek ve kişiselleştirilmiş vergi tavsiyesi sağlamak için kullanılmaktadır.

Örnek: YZ, işlemleri otomatik olarak kategorize etmek ve potansiyel vergi indirimlerini belirlemek için kullanılabilir.

Bulut Bilişim

Bulut bilişim, vergi yazılımını, özellikle küçük işletmeler için daha erişilebilir ve uygun fiyatlı hale getiriyor.

Blok Zinciri Teknolojisi

Blok zinciri teknolojisi, vergi işlemlerinin şeffaflığını ve güvenliğini iyileştirme potansiyeline sahiptir.

Gerçek Zamanlı Vergi Hesaplaması

Gerçek zamanlı vergi hesaplaması, özellikle her işlem için satış vergisini hesaplaması gereken e-ticaret işletmeleri için giderek daha önemli hale geliyor.

Vergi Algoritması Uygulamasına Küresel Bakış Açıları

Vergi algoritmalarının uygulanması, vergi sistemlerindeki, düzenleyici çerçevelerindeki ve teknolojik altyapılarındaki farklılıkları yansıtarak, farklı ülkelerde ve bölgelerde önemli ölçüde farklılık gösterir. İşte bazı örnekler:

Amerika Birleşik Devletleri

Amerika Birleşik Devletleri, federal, eyalet ve yerel vergiler içeren karmaşık bir vergi sistemine sahiptir. ABD'deki vergi yazılımı, gelir vergisi, satış vergisi, emlak vergisi ve bordro vergisi dahil olmak üzere çok çeşitli vergi hesaplamalarını yapabilmelidir.

Örnek: Satış vergisi kuralları eyalete, ilçeye ve hatta şehre göre değişir ve her işlem için doğru vergi oranını belirlemek için gelişmiş algoritmalar gerektirir. Yazılım ayrıca ekonomik bağ yasalarını da hesaba katmalıdır.

Avrupa Birliği

Avrupa Birliği, uyumlu bir KDV sistemine sahiptir, ancak KDV oranları ve kuralları üye devletler arasında değişiklik göstermektedir. AB'deki vergi yazılımı, sınır ötesi işlemler için KDV hesaplamalarını yapabilmeli ve her üye devletin KDV düzenlemelerine uymalıdır.

Örnek: AB'deki tüketicilere çevrimiçi mal satan şirketler, KDV raporlama ve ödeme için "Tek Durak Mağazası" (TDM) düzenlemesine uymak zorundadır.

Kanada

Kanada, eyalete göre değişen bir mal ve hizmet vergisi (GST) ve eyalet satış vergilerine (PST) sahiptir. Kanada'daki vergi yazılımı, farklı eyaletler arasındaki işlemler için GST/HST ve PST hesaplamalarını yapabilmelidir.

Avustralya

Avustralya'da bir mal ve hizmet vergisi (GST) ve gelir vergisi vardır. Avustralya'daki vergi yazılımı, bireyler ve işletmeler için GST ve gelir vergisi hesaplamalarını yapabilmelidir.

Gelişmekte Olan Pazarlar

Gelişmekte olan pazarlarda, vergi yazılımı genellikle vergi uyumluluğunu otomatikleştirmek ve vergi tahsilatını iyileştirmek için kullanılır. Ancak, vergi yazılımının benimsenmesi, internet erişiminin olmaması ve sınırlı dijital okuryazarlık gibi faktörlerle sınırlı olabilir.

İşletmeler İçin Eyleme Geçirilebilir Bilgiler

İşte vergi yazılımı ve algoritmalarından yararlanmak isteyen işletmeler için bazı eyleme geçirilebilir bilgiler:

Sonuç

Vergi hesaplama algoritmaları, bireylerin ve işletmelerin vergi uyumunun karmaşıklıklarında verimli ve doğru bir şekilde gezinmelerini sağlayan modern vergi yazılımının bel kemiğidir. Bu algoritmalarla ilişkili temel ilkeleri, işlevselliği ve zorlukları anlamak, bunların tüm potansiyelinden yararlanmak için çok önemlidir. Vergi yasaları gelişmeye ve teknoloji ilerledikçe, vergi algoritmaları vergilendirmenin geleceğini şekillendirmede giderek daha önemli bir rol oynayacaktır.

Vergi algoritmalarının nüanslarını anlayarak, işletmeler vergi stratejileri hakkında bilinçli kararlar verebilir, vergi uyum süreçlerini optimize edebilir ve sonuç olarak, giderek karmaşıklaşan bir küresel vergi ortamında finansal performanslarını iyileştirebilirler. Ayrıca, vergi algoritması uygulamasına ilişkin küresel bakış açılarını anlamak, çok uluslu şirketlerin dünya genelinde düzenlemelere uyduğundan emin olmalarına yardımcı olabilir.

Vergi Yazılımını Çözümlemek: Hesaplama Algoritmalarına Derinlemesine Bakış | MLOG